Brown professor named to Care New England board

PROVIDENCE – Diane Lipscombe, a professor in the Department of Neuroscience at Brown University, has been appointed to the board of directors at Care New England.
Lipscombe has served on the Brown faculty since 1990, where she teaches Advanced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. She served as the director of the Neuroscience Graduate program from 2005 to 2011.
Lipscombe is the principal investigator of a major institutional pre-doctoral training grant from the National Institutes of Health. She received the Harriet Sheridan Award for Distinguished Teaching in 2009 and the Faculty Mentorship Award from the graduate school in 2010.
“We are pleased that Professor Lipscombe accepted our invitation to join Care New England’s board as we continue to navigate significant changes in the health care landscape,” said Dennis Keefe, president and CEO of Care New England. “Her experience and perspective as a teacher, researcher and administrator will prove invaluable as work toward ever increasing levels of academic excellence.”
